Output dd69aac6b155f625b664bed2ee1deded77fd03dc1bc09f4fed46f3b149a4d67d:1

value
994741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ed489ded9b3ad536972e88040f6b2d1b13099e OP_EQUAL
address
39tWKNfesQPXAQzcbm4XmXcJZXPggMGFLD
transaction
dd69aac6b155f625b664bed2ee1deded77fd03dc1bc09f4fed46f3b149a4d67d
confirmations
166779
spent
true